Commit graph

  • 7342c2555e userinput and showhelp as util functions in Command class Bela 2018-04-07 09:52:55 +0200
  • c0096174ad fix: return original value if no time is to be added Bela 2018-04-07 09:52:21 +0200
  • d549d8b893 todo: refactor call Bela 2018-04-07 09:51:18 +0200
  • ebdee44577 new todo: ifs tweaking for empty values Bela 2018-04-06 23:27:52 +0200
  • b1b0b4e328 fix: stampPdf instead of stamppdf Bela 2018-04-06 23:26:24 +0200
  • b0673469ee check failure of pdf filling including check if FieldStateOptions are regarded Bela 2018-04-06 23:25:20 +0200
  • 62bb695b2e fix: bytes != str Bela 2018-04-06 23:24:07 +0200
  • 6adb3fdb28 fix: pdftk multistamp needs different output to input Bela 2018-04-06 23:23:50 +0200
  • 9e9bdaf289 fix Ifcondition (missing SUBINFO_SEP) Bela 2018-04-05 07:59:31 +0200
  • 855528a713 better input message Bela 2018-04-05 07:58:57 +0200
  • ce87cc2116 remove debug message Bela 2018-04-05 07:58:10 +0200
  • 317b2e3791 more todos Bela 2018-04-03 13:59:03 +0200
  • d5a68a8f2d creation of config files including options in radiobutton Bela 2018-04-03 13:53:58 +0200
  • 6dc1a6091e comment text in stamps because the necessary import caused a circular import Bela 2018-04-03 13:52:44 +0200
  • becdc3a927 restructure: move writing to pdfs into own module writetopdf Bela 2018-04-03 13:51:54 +0200
  • 7b313e7163 explanation for name 'stamp' Bela 2018-03-29 20:05:00 +0200
  • fb978140e2 explanation for stamps Bela 2018-03-29 20:03:12 +0200
  • 88ae4f76ea fillpdf include stamping Bela 2018-03-29 19:46:09 +0200
  • 1c90e8fc5c rename because module does more than originally expected Bela 2018-03-29 19:42:56 +0200
  • 127ebb4b7f text of stamptemplate. Works like a sharm :) Bela 2018-03-29 19:37:56 +0200
  • 8091e16ed4 stamp pdf with data from formfields Bela 2018-03-29 19:37:33 +0200
  • e3e33e502f fix in Stamp & FormFieldlistextraction Bela 2018-03-29 19:36:38 +0200
  • 4cbd8dad72 todo: more configds Bela 2018-03-29 19:35:55 +0200
  • d680b24206 adjusted pdfcreation Bela 2018-03-29 18:32:02 +0200
  • 4cf1bd55f6 comment Bela 2018-03-29 18:31:39 +0200
  • d222a38c89 refactor stamptemplate with class Stamp that represents one block of text Bela 2018-03-29 18:27:27 +0200
  • 4b429dfd29 temporary fix for circular dependance: subclasses of Command listed by hand, needs refactoring Bela 2018-03-29 18:19:54 +0200
  • 9cbe4f7fd5 stamptemplate V1: printing text at arbtirary spots in pdf Bela 2018-03-29 16:52:49 +0200
  • cbe544bc8e remove done todos Bela 2018-03-21 18:54:31 +0100
  • e79b0174a0 remove done todos Bela 2018-03-21 18:53:42 +0100
  • c4cdeb7174 removed todos in help Bela 2018-03-21 18:52:42 +0100
  • 4fb3208075 doc: mainconfig with data Bela 2018-03-21 18:45:31 +0100
  • 1a1eb53968 constant extraction documented Bela 2018-03-21 18:35:47 +0100
  • c0297d5d5c argument parsing improved. Overwriting files now allowed. Bela 2018-03-21 18:32:56 +0100
  • 36bb06f841 move all constants in one module for simplification. Juchhea Bela 2018-03-21 18:32:05 +0100
  • 17a92a47d8 doc for MobileRegex, config-constants Bela 2018-03-21 17:49:17 +0100
  • 67b8998da8 generalise findByFieldName: filter included Bela 2018-03-21 17:48:35 +0100
  • b87ef60984 except KeyboardInterrupt in order to allow finishing at other time Bela 2018-03-21 17:47:55 +0100
  • d21e27b1b1 first draft: read data paths from config Bela 2018-03-21 17:47:12 +0100
  • 64f8400d51 in fillpdf ignore non-formfields Bela 2018-03-21 17:46:44 +0100
  • 7e3a0a5445 tiny pep8 fix in help Bela 2018-03-21 17:46:05 +0100
  • 20b049af13 readformdata: except missing file Bela 2018-03-21 16:49:13 +0100
  • dfaf78b924 remove done todos Bela 2018-03-20 18:08:02 +0100
  • 03db16f42d in help of fillform: default descriptions Bela 2018-03-20 18:07:37 +0100
  • be34610d69 help for fillform Bela 2018-03-20 18:07:14 +0100
  • fa30359101 utf8 in pdftk call Bela 2018-03-18 23:52:09 +0100
  • 078da55e53 fix typos in commands Bela 2018-03-18 23:51:12 +0100
  • 7b67a538d7 first draft of specification of the config files Bela 2018-03-18 22:51:55 +0100
  • 8982c67ff7 add property name to simplify getting a name for a field for debug/ error messages Bela 2018-03-15 14:35:01 +0100
  • e20f5e23c6 for default, add possibility to shift time. Bela 2018-03-15 14:34:20 +0100
  • 5017068b85 sort commands by priority Bela 2018-03-15 13:34:32 +0100
  • ffe9e270c2 ignore copyright warning Bela 2018-03-15 13:34:03 +0100
  • 18c40f5ebe fix: KeyError Bela 2018-03-15 13:33:46 +0100
  • 3b21b9d21a introduced Command Choice for Buttons Bela 2018-03-15 13:32:42 +0100
  • 7e0b59204e in command Question empty answers are handled (now really) Bela 2018-03-15 13:32:17 +0100
  • 4c1bcffa1f in Command Default missing values from variables admit a warning message but no error Bela 2018-03-15 13:31:37 +0100
  • f94425c241 in command Question empty answers are handled Bela 2018-03-15 13:30:37 +0100
  • 158863e81a evaluation of conditions for commands Bela 2018-03-15 13:29:33 +0100
  • a2e7ce44f3 there can be several commands of the same kind for one field Bela 2018-03-15 13:29:07 +0100
  • 102dec2dc6 command Default Bela 2018-03-14 18:32:40 +0100
  • 4379a5e929 fix list info recognition Bela 2018-03-14 18:29:27 +0100
  • 1ff1bacee7 argument form for output form file added Bela 2018-03-14 18:28:48 +0100
  • 6f49b25ded Command: Variable replacement with errors or default in case of missing value Bela 2018-03-14 18:27:46 +0100
  • e36784f424 fields that can appear sevaral times are now stored in the util class MobileRegex in readformdata Bela 2018-03-13 16:22:51 +0100
  • ac117621d7 tiny fix Bela 2018-03-12 17:11:06 +0100
  • 9566b3f8a2 data file input changed: each needs the ref which appears in config file in variables, --data can be specified several times now Bela 2018-03-12 17:10:46 +0100
  • aae4a29b0e several small fixes & write data to some form file (argument for that, missing: default) Bela 2018-02-22 21:58:59 +0100
  • d1cff966ea fill pdf with data implemented Bela 2018-02-22 21:58:16 +0100
  • debe75e11e put writing fields into a function Bela 2018-02-22 21:56:21 +0100
  • 9b07ca5b7b for testing some lines Bela 2018-02-21 22:36:45 +0100
  • a10b74253b argparse: added file existing check plus add defaults Bela 2018-02-21 22:36:32 +0100
  • e2d9da9c42 fillform executable Bela 2018-02-21 22:34:00 +0100
  • c27cae616e add typical iteration for formfield. TODO: make this standard and update all use cases Bela 2018-02-21 22:33:25 +0100
  • 2aded0f088 extract Commands from FormField infos Bela 2018-02-21 22:32:45 +0100
  • 3fcd5ef416 cosmetic changes to doc of Question Bela 2018-02-21 22:32:24 +0100
  • 7dd823220b start fillform with argument parsing Bela 2018-02-16 13:43:34 +0100
  • 3bd1bc6945 a beginning of commands, should be sufficiant for first tests Bela 2018-02-16 13:14:06 +0100
  • 3c836c4f29 add search in FormField lists for FieldName Bela 2018-02-16 13:13:38 +0100
  • dd8ea4088e add CONSTANTS for config file and ConfigError Bela 2018-02-16 13:13:15 +0100
  • 711a74f0da add Constant SUBINFO_SEP Bela 2018-02-16 13:12:44 +0100
  • 0520c310e8 restructering: FormField on its own while reading/ writing config data in readformdata.py Bela 2018-02-15 21:43:25 +0100
  • 90eb325464 ignore pycache Bela 2018-02-15 21:42:50 +0100
  • 9b2bc16c8a fix umlaut handling Bela 2018-02-15 20:41:35 +0100
  • 836c02060f remove debug prints Bela 2018-02-15 10:39:04 +0100
  • 7aba4b6ffe total refactoring of identify, userinput is not different from pdf data Bela 2018-02-15 01:02:05 +0100
  • cc6b60884f ignore rope stuff: python help Bela 2018-02-15 01:01:11 +0100
  • 7d4a664dbc todo: evince richtig nutzen Bela 2018-02-08 11:10:40 +0100
  • 15f7cef715 add class FormField with user input for basic information Bela 2018-02-08 11:08:38 +0100
  • af3bd3932f read form fields from pdftk output Bela 2018-02-07 16:27:15 +0100
  • dc3ca010de erste Informationssammlung Bela 2018-02-07 14:22:32 +0100